WebIn 2012, two employees working at a onnecticut hotel attempted to adjust pool chemical levels in the hotel swimming pool unaware that the employer had changed chemical suppliers. The employee choose the pool chemicals by lid color and container size instead of reading the label and unknowingly added muriatic acid to the chlorine feeder. WebIn most commercial pools, primary chlorine is stored in a specific room, and if there is a secondary shock, like granular cal hypo, it is kept in either a different room, or at least 10 feet (~3 m) away. Good ventilation is key. If chlorine and acid are mixed together, the fumes are toxic and potentially lethal. WebDownload DOCX - 290.28 KB. WebAlways leave chemicals in their purchased containers and, when storing, keep varying chemicals away from one another. When mixing, use a stir stick, board, pole, etc. Never use an arm, hand, or tool you need for other purposes. Never leave pool chemicals in the vicinity of combustible materials like paints and gas. Chlorine-containing chemicals are commonly used in swimming pools as part of the routine water treatment. While such chemicals help to disinfect the water, care must be taken to ensure that they are used in a safe manner as improper storage and handling of these chemicals may result in spills and release of chlorine gas.
